Men advance with a flamethrower tank and go past a burning Japanese machine gun nest in Saipan, Mariana Islands.

Activities of United States Marines in Saipan, Mariana Islands during World War II. A marine advances towards cliffs. An ocean in the background. Men advance across an open field. A half track armored tank and men advance down hill. They go past a burning Japanese machine gun nest. The tank advances along a road. A man kneels down in cane grass with a weapon on shoulder. Other men on the top of a hill observe a fire in a valley. The men advance along the side of the hill. A M3 Stuart Light Tank M3A1 with a flamethrower advances along a road. The flamethrower tank fires into a wooded area.

U.S. Marines inspect bodies of dead Japanese soldiers and throw demolition charges on a battlefield in Saipan, Mariana Islands.

Activities of United States Marines in Saipan, Mariana Islands during World War II. A M3 Stuart light Tank (M3A1) mounted with a flamethrower. Dead Japanese bodies smoking. The head of a dead Japanese soldier with blood oozing out of a ear. Two marines throw a demolition charge into a Japanese cave. Explosion from the demolition charges. Men advance along a cliff. A dead Japanese sniper hanging from a tree. The marines inspect the body of a dead Japanese soldier. The flamethrower tank throws flames into an enemy cave.
